Abstract

A method for driving a light-emitting semiconductor is provided. A supply voltage is converted into a secondary output voltage for supplying the light-emitting semiconductor with an output voltage. A level for the supply voltage at the beginning of a high current phase of the light-emitting semiconductor is sensed. A threshold voltage level for the supply voltage level is determined based on the sensed level. The high current phase with the light-emitting semiconductor is stated. The sensed level is continuously compared with the threshold voltage level, and an output current through the light-emitting semiconductor is controlled such that the sensed level does not drop below the threshold voltage level.
